Understanding Java and CSS file formats
Java files use the .java extension and contain source code written in the Java programming language. These files are compiled into bytecode to run on the Java Virtual Machine (JVM). Java files are primarily used for software development and do not contain styling or layout information for web pages.
CSS files use the .css extension and are used to define the style and layout of HTML documents. CSS (Cascading Style Sheets) files contain rules for formatting elements on web pages, such as colors, fonts, spacing, and positioning.
Can you convert Java to CSS?
Direct conversion from Java to CSS is not typical, as these formats serve entirely different purposes. Java is for programming logic, while CSS is for web page styling. However, if your Java file contains embedded CSS as strings or comments, you can manually extract the CSS code.
How to extract CSS from Java files
If your Java file contains CSS code (for example, as part of a web application), follow these steps:
- Open the .java file in a text editor such as Notepad++, VS Code, or Sublime Text.
- Locate the CSS code within the Java file. This may be inside string literals or comments.
- Copy the CSS code.
- Create a new file and save it with a .css extension.
- Paste the copied CSS code into the new file and save it.

Automated extraction using scripts
If you have many Java files with embedded CSS, you can use a script to automate extraction. For example, a Python script can search for CSS patterns within Java files and write them to a .css file.
Summary
There is no direct converter for Java to CSS, as they serve different roles. Manual or scripted extraction is the best approach if your Java files contain CSS code.
